Shanghai-based online news outlet ThePaper, reported on Friday that staff at fresh produce supermarket, Hema Fresh, which has a branch on Guangling Second Road in Hongkou district had also prepared a range of bouquets, mostly roses and carnations, for residents to celebrate the day despite the epidemic.

Chen Peng, head of the store, told media that staffs have been arranging deliveries since Wednesday. "Our goal is to get the flowers to their recipients on time," he was quoted as saying by the news portal. "Some residents bought flowers not only to show their love, but also to brighten up their lives during lockdown."
